COLUMBUS, Ohio, Aug. 31 (UPI) -- There is no reason to be blue in Columbus, following Ohio State's national championship season.

But on the rare chance that you happen to wear the color blue in coach Urban Meyer's classroom, you will immediately regret it.

Buckeyes assistant coach Tony Alford posted a picture to Instagram Monday. Alford's photo showed Meyer pointing to the floor after spotting several blue-wearing students. His reaction was to give the Michigan color-clad violators pushup ultimatums.

Meyer teaches "Coaching Football" at Ohio State, according to the Detroit Free Press.

During his lengthy tenure at Ohio State, Jim Tressel also presided in the classroom.
